    • @mark62891
      @mark62891 4 ปีที่แล้ว +2

      @@lihuasun7847 I mean their categories are complimentary. Green card gets 3x on generic travel categories like flights and uber and restaurants. The Surpass gets 12x at Hilton properties (plus gold status) the 6x on restaurants, supermarkets, and gas stations. The only overlapping category is the restaurant.
      I do cross-country drives frequently usually Texas to Washington. I stay in hotels (for 1 night) along the way then stay at Airbnbs for several weeks before returning. So I get a great value from the occasional free night and free breakfast then use my built up MR points (from Airbnb for free trips)

    • @LK_EBM
      @LK_EBM ปีที่แล้ว

      Do the math. Where will you (realistically) be using the free night at?
      For example, if you stay at a $700 hotel.
      $700 value for $15k spend = 4.6% return on spend.
      You're CFU gets 1.5 UR points. Will you realistically get ~3 CPP from UR, to beat out the Hilton?
